Diamantidis sets one, ties with Pargo on another assists record
The two All-Euroleague point guards for the 2010-11 season, Dimitris Diamantidis of Panathinaikos and Jeremy Pargo of Maccabi Electra, etched their name into the Euroleague record books as the former’s team beat the latter’s in a thrilling 2011 Turkish Airlines Euroleague Final Four title game on Sunday. With 18 assists this weekend, Diamantidis set a new Euroleague standard for assists in the Final Four. At the same time, both he and Pargo tied the competition record for assists in the title game with 9.
The previous mark for assists in a single Final Four was 17, shared by Vasily Karasev of CSKA Moscow, who accomplished the feat in 1996 in Paris and Terrell McIntyre of Montepaschi Siena who tied his in 2008 in Madrid. Arriel McDonald, who ironically played with both Maccabi Tel Aviv and Panathinaikos in his career, had owned the title game assists mark with 9 dishes when he played for the former against the latter in the 2001 SuproLeague final in Paris.
